Norway’s ambassador to India, May-Elin Stener, said she and the British High Commissioner to India, Lindy Cameron, are ready for a “blockbuster” clash as England and Norway meet at Hard Rock Stadium in Florida on Saturday (local time). The announcement came through a video posted on X by Stener, showing both diplomats taking part in a light-hearted “this or that” comparison. The playful segment matched England’s fish and chips against Norway’s salmon, compared England’s rolling hills with Norway’s Northern Lights, and set afternoon tea against coffee and waffles. In the football category, the challenge paired Harry Kane with Erling Haaland. On the pitch, England reached the last eight for the 11th time after a 3–2 Round of 16 win over Mexico, while Norway advanced by beating Brazil 2–1, with Haaland scoring both goals and taking his debut World Cup tally to seven.
